Not a great photo, but interesting to me.
I was hiking around Castlewood State Park (just west of St. Louis, MO) and noticed this guy sitting on a stick just a couple feet away. He looked a little thin around the hind legs, and as I moved in closer he also seemed a little "flat".
The photo shows what might be the problem:

I definitely see one tick in the ear opening, and possibly another in the fold above the right front leg. A little more depth-of-field would help.
I took about 15 shots, moving closer with each photo. I finally violated his personal space and he bolted into the weeds.
